Liked it. Seeing I'm not such a fan of things like gowns, shoes, and tiaras, I could proudly say I liked the book, if not loved it. Given I had completely stood outside my comfort zone, I could say I was not entirely disappointed through the entirety of the series.

Sure I had kind of predicted everything from the start with some of it's cliche ordeals, but what can I say? I'm a sucker for it ;)

TEAM MAXON FOREVER!

Btw, I totally predicted the death of the king. Too bad for the queen though. I liked her.

I'll admit I've grown frustrated with America quite a few times, but who didn't? She's just too damn stubborn and can't make up her mind! But all in all I love the characters. I love Celeste- especially in the last part- I know it was all for show, and I loved how she humbled herself down when she knew it was already a lost cause. That girl has guts!

Rated 4 out of 5, this book isn't entirely bad. I adore Kiera Cass for creating a series as good as this. Looking forward to reading her future works, and hopefully, my reaction would be as good as I this, if not greater.

Aside from the book, I also love the cover, and I would be kind of guilty for admitting the fact that I judge the book from the way it's cover was put up. Admit it, you do too. If I were to rate the cover alone, I'd give it a straight out ten! (Don't bother with five, I'll take the 2 digits anytime!) It just gives out that aura of exquisiteness if you know what I mean.

I recommend this book for everyone who is a fan of the fine cliche. Nothing goes wrong with a little love triangle. It's a dystopian world I wouldn't mind living in, (well, without the castes of course.)
